当前位置: 首页 > news >正文

终极Android投屏解决方案:scrcpy完整使用教程

终极Android投屏解决方案:scrcpy完整使用教程

【免费下载链接】scrcpyDisplay and control your Android device项目地址: https://gitcode.com/GitHub_Trending/sc/scrcpy

你是否曾想过将手机屏幕完美投射到电脑上,用键盘鼠标轻松操作?Android投屏工具scrcpy正是你需要的终极解决方案!这款开源神器让你无需root权限就能实现高清、低延迟的屏幕镜像,无论是办公演示、游戏直播还是应用测试都能轻松搞定。今天,我们就来全面掌握这款无线投屏工具的核心功能和使用技巧。

为什么选择scrcpy?三大核心优势

在众多Android投屏工具中,scrcpy凭借其轻量级、高性能和完全免费的特性脱颖而出。与其他需要安装手机APP的投屏软件不同,scrcpy无需在设备上安装任何应用,不会留下痕迹,且完全开源无广告。

性能表现超乎想象

  • 极速启动:1秒内显示手机画面
  • 高清画质:支持1920×1080及以上分辨率
  • 流畅体验:30-120fps自适应帧率
  • 超低延迟:仅35-70ms延迟,几乎无感

功能全面覆盖需求

从基础屏幕镜像到高级音频传输,scrcpy几乎满足你对手机投屏的所有想象。最棒的是,这一切都是免费的!

三步快速上手无线投屏

第一步:准备工作

  1. 在电脑上安装scrcpy(支持Windows、macOS、Linux)
  2. 开启手机的USB调试模式
  3. 用USB线连接手机和电脑

第二步:最简单的启动方式

scrcpy

没错,就是这么简单!输入这个命令,你的手机屏幕就会立即出现在电脑上。

第三步:基础操作指南

  • 鼠标点击:直接在电脑上操作手机
  • 键盘输入:用电脑键盘打字到手机上
  • 拖放文件:轻松传输文件

核心功能详解:解锁实用技巧

无线投屏连接设置

摆脱USB线的束缚,享受无线自由:

scrcpy --tcpip=192.168.1.100

通过Wi-Fi连接手机,让投屏更加灵活便捷。

高质量屏幕录制技巧

想要录制手机操作教程或游戏过程?scrcpy的录制功能绝对专业:

scrcpy --record=my_video.mp4

支持同时录制视频和音频,让你的录制效果更完美。

音频同步传输设置

从Android 11开始,scrcpy支持音频传输:

scrcpy --audio

看电影、听音乐、玩游戏,声音都能同步到电脑!

虚拟显示器功能

想要更大的显示空间?开启虚拟显示器:

scrcpy --display-id=2

这样就能在电脑上看到手机的扩展屏幕。

实战场景应用案例

办公演示场景

产品经理小张经常需要向团队展示手机APP原型。使用scrcpy后,他可以直接在会议室大屏幕上展示手机操作,团队成员看得清清楚楚,沟通效率大大提升!

游戏直播场景

游戏主播小李发现,用scrcpy投屏手机游戏到电脑,再通过OBS推流,画质比传统录屏软件好太多!而且延迟极低,观众体验大幅改善。

应用开发测试场景

程序员小王在开发Android应用时,用scrcpy快速测试不同手机上的显示效果。他可以在电脑上同时操作多台测试机,大大提高了测试效率。

常见问题解决方案

Q:为什么我的手机连接不上?

A:请确保已经打开了USB调试模式。在手机开发者选项中开启"USB调试",并选择"文件传输"模式。

Q:投屏有延迟怎么办?

A:可以尝试降低分辨率或帧率:

scrcpy --max-size=1024 --max-fps=30

Q:如何录制高质量视频?

A:使用更高的比特率和分辨率:

scrcpy --record=output.mp4 --video-bit-rate=8M --max-size=1920

Q:无线连接不稳定怎么解决?

A:确保手机和电脑在同一个Wi-Fi网络下,信号良好。可以尝试使用5GHz频段。

进阶技巧分享

连接稳定性优化

  • 尽量使用USB 3.0以上的数据线
  • 无线连接时,让设备尽量靠近路由器
  • 关闭不必要的后台应用,释放手机性能

画质与性能平衡

  • 日常使用:scrcpy --max-size=1280
  • 游戏投屏:scrcpy --max-fps=60 --video-bit-rate=6M
  • 文档演示:scrcpy --bit-rate=2M --max-size=1920

快捷键使用技巧

掌握这些快捷键,操作效率翻倍:

  • Ctrl+h:返回主屏幕
  • Ctrl+f:切换全屏模式
  • Ctrl+p:截图保存
  • Ctrl+r:开始/停止录制

进一步学习资源

想要深入了解scrcpy的更多功能?可以查看官方文档:doc/了解详细的技术细节和高级功能。

对源码感兴趣?核心功能实现位于:app/src/,你可以深入了解其内部工作原理。

配置示例和检查规则可在:config/中找到。

scrcpy的强大之处在于它的开源和可扩展性。无论是简单的屏幕镜像,还是复杂的自动化控制,它都能胜任。现在就开始你的scrcpy之旅吧,你会发现一个全新的手机使用体验!

记住,最好的学习方式就是动手尝试。打开终端,输入scrcpy,让我们一起探索这个神奇的Android投屏工具!

【免费下载链接】scrcpyDisplay and control your Android device项目地址: https://gitcode.com/GitHub_Trending/sc/scrcpy

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1129415/

相关文章:

  • Three.js 城市光效教程
  • Zod入门指南:3分钟掌握TypeScript数据验证的终极解决方案
  • Material Dashboard Lite自定义教程:轻松修改主题颜色与样式
  • mysql_sysbench在openEuler/service_trainning中的应用:性能测试实战教程
  • ENFUGUE API开发指南:如何集成AI图像生成到你的应用
  • GDash高级技巧:时间区间自定义、全屏展示与多Graphite后端配置
  • Playnite:一站式游戏库管理解决方案,整合20+平台与模拟器
  • Ascend C uint8转half函数文档
  • 终极Gamdl技术架构深度解析:构建高效的Apple Music下载流水线
  • BTTV安卓版技术架构演进:从简单修改到完整模块化系统
  • 微信小程序食品安全管理系统:全链路设计与开发实战
  • JSON.simple容器工厂实战:ContainerFactory自定义Map和List容器
  • Swift开发者必看:Objective-C-RegEx-Categories桥接与使用指南
  • rawpy错误处理:全面解析LibRawError异常体系与调试技巧
  • todo[bot]测试策略:如何编写高质量的GitHub应用测试用例
  • Andromeda Web API详解:Canvas、Crypto与SQLite集成
  • 如何用离线OCR工具在3分钟内完成图片文字提取?
  • KMX63与PIC18LF25K40硬件协同与自然交互实现
  • DataMapper Core核心组件解析:Identity Map如何确保对象唯一性与内存优化
  • Instatic服务器资源规划:CPU、内存与存储需求终极指南
  • FXTest接口自动化测试平台:一站式Python+Flask接口测试解决方案
  • Sync配置详解:自定义目录监控、日志输出与桌面通知全攻略
  • SeaTunnel Web 任务调度与管理:如何高效管理海量数据同步任务
  • Teku贡献者指南:如何为开源以太坊共识客户端提交代码
  • Twitter API Client错误处理:10个常见问题与解决方案
  • Cargo-script 的未来发展:Rust 脚本生态系统的前景展望
  • STM32与IS31FL3731实现高效LED矩阵控制方案
  • 如何使用Adminer管理wordpress-nginx-docker数据库:安全高效的数据操作指南
  • FlagGems与FlagScale集成教程:构建企业级大模型训练平台
  • ENFUGUE TensorRT加速教程:如何让AI图像生成速度翻倍